YouTube Star Ms. Rachel Vows to Risk Career for Gaza’s Children

Her WBUR interview underscores her commitment to spotlight Gaza’s dire situation despite calls for a probe into her social media posts.

Overview

  • In a June 4 WBUR interview, Rachel Accurso said she would repeatedly risk her career to stand up for children in Gaza.
  • On May 21 she shared a video of 3-year-old Rahaf, who lost her legs in an airstrike, dancing to her song, prompting StopAntisemitism to urge a Justice Department inquiry.
  • Accurso launched a May 2024 fundraiser for children in Gaza, Sudan, Ukraine and the Democratic Republic of the Congo and reported facing bullying over the effort.
  • In April she donated $1 million to World Food Program USA to provide meals for starving populations in Afghanistan, Syria, Yemen and 11 other countries.
  • UN agencies report more than 54,000 killed in Gaza and warn the territory’s entire population faces famine, driving her humanitarian advocacy.
